Each oral presentation is allocated 15 minutes in total:
The chairperson is responsible for monitoring the timing so that all presenters receive equal presentation time. Please rehearse your presentation in advance and keep it within the allocated 12 minutes.
All presentations must be delivered in English.
Upload your final presentation to SlideCrew no later than 30 minutes before the start of your session.
Please arrive at your session room at least 15 minutes before the scheduled start time. This allows the speakers to confirm the presentation order and chairing arrangements before the session begins.
If you are the first speaker listed in your session, you will also act as chairperson.

ISAM 2026 uses SlideCrew as its official presentation management system.

If you are presenting in more than one session, each presentation will be linked to the appropriate session.
Uploading your slides in advance is strongly recommended. SlideCrew checks your file for potential issues involving fonts, compatibility, video, audio and file integrity.
SlideCrew staff will be available in the Speaker Slide Centre throughout the congress.

Please arrive at your assigned session room at least 15 minutes before the scheduled start time.
Meet the other speakers, confirm the presentation order and make sure that everyone is aware of the chairing arrangements. Follow any additional instructions provided by the room technician or congress team.
Oral presentation sessions do not have a separately appointed chairperson. The first speaker listed in the session will act as chairperson.

Your presentation will already be available on the congress presentation computer. Presenters cannot connect their own laptops or present directly from a USB drive.

After your presentation, approximately three minutes are reserved for audience questions and discussion.
The chairperson will moderate the discussion and ensure that the session remains on schedule. An audience microphone will be available in the room, and delegates will be asked to use it when asking a question.
